Необходимо сравнить заданное входное изображение лица с уже сохраненной помеченной коллекцией с помощью AWS - PullRequest
0 голосов
/ 10 апреля 2019

У меня есть коллекция изображений профиля от клиентов. Мне нужно иметь возможность передать селфи человека, отсканировать его по коллекции изображений и получить информацию о клиенте.

Необходимо сделать следующееИспользование AWS Rekognition -

  • Создание коллекции - Готово
  • Добавление изображений в коллекцию - Что такое синтаксис REST API для этого
  • При добавлении изображений в коллекциютакже пометьте его именем клиента.
  • Сделайте портрет селфи, выполните поиск по коллекции и верните информацию о теге, которая соответствует.

Я использую Flutter в качестве платформы, следовательно, нетподдержка AWS SDK, поэтому необходимо будет выполнять вызовы REST API.Однако документы AWS не предоставляют много информации для поддержки REST.

1 Ответ

0 голосов
/ 10 апреля 2019

API документированы.Например, чтобы определить лица на изображении и добавить их в коллекцию, см. IndexFaces .

. Я бы лично посоветовал освоиться с Rekognition через awscli (или Python / boto3), прежде чемвы переходите к API отдыха.

На фронте тегов имен вы назначаете «внешний идентификатор» лицам при добавлении их в коллекцию.Этот внешний идентификатор является коррелятором, который вы предоставляете и который хранит Rekognition.Позже, когда вы спрашиваете Rekognition, соответствует ли данное лицо тому, которое уже есть в коллекции, Rekognition вернет вам внешний идентификатор.Затем его можно использовать для поиска в базе данных, в которой вы должны указать имя человека, дату его рождения или что-то еще.

...